Full Cast & Crew of Stoner

  • Angela Mao Ying – Angela Li Shou-Hua
  • George Lazenby – Joseph Stoner
  • Hwang In-shik – Mr. Big
  • Betty Ting Pei – Wang Yen Yen
  • Joji Takagi – Mr. Chin
